comparemela.com
Home
Budhpur Alipur
Top Budhpur Alipur | Reviews & Ratings | comparemela.com
Budhpur alipur in India - 110036/ near delhi/ near north-west-delhi
1.Budhpur, Alipur, Delhi
2.Budhpur, Alipur, Delhi
3.Budhpur, Alipur, Delhi